Answer : The speed of the wave is 851 m/s

Explanation :

It is given that,

Wavelength of a wave is, λ = 2.3 m

The frequency of the wave is, υ = 370 Hz

The speed of the wave is given as :

[tex]speed=\dfrac{distance}{time}[/tex]

In case of wave, the distance is equal to the wavelength of the wave and the time taken is equal to the inverse of frequency i.e. [tex]T=\dfrac{1}{\nu}[/tex].

So, [tex]v=\dfrac{\lambda}{T}[/tex]

or [tex]v=\nu \times \lambda[/tex]

[tex]v=370\ Hz\times 2.3\ m[/tex]

v = 851 m/s

So, the speed of the wave is 851 m/s
